In order to realize these purposes and other advantages according to the present utility model, a kind of power-assisted rotary bicycle is provided,
Including:
Guide rail, round circular orbit, the guide rail are placed vertically;
Rotating arm, one end are rotatably installed at circular orbit center, other end stationary bicycle, bicycle wheels with
Face contact on the inside of round circular orbit;
Fixed station is trapezoidal erecting bed, and described rotating arm one end is rotatably installed in fixed station upper end;
Wherein, the rotating arm other end is equipped with shaft, former and later two vehicle frames of bicycle are rotatablely connected in shaft, described
Spring is equipped with above bicycle Rear frame, the shaft interlocks decelerating motor main shaft, and decelerating motor offer helps when bicycle rises
Power, decelerating motor provides resistance when bicycle declines.
Preferably, the guide rail two sides are fixed guide rail by installing column vertically.
Preferably, the effective distance of the rotating arm and bicycle is equal to round circular orbit radius.
Preferably, the fixed station is located at guide rail side, and fixed station height is greater than guide rail radius and is less than diameter.
Preferably, the bicycle is equipped with safety belt.
Preferably, the minimum point contact ground of the guide rail or slightly above ground.

Fig. 1 shows a kind of way of realization according to the present utility model, including:Guide rail 1, guide rail 1 are circular ring shape rail
Road, the guide rail 1 are placed vertically;2 one end of rotating arm is rotatably installed at circular orbit center, other end stationary bicycle 3, from
Face contact on the inside of 3 front and back wheels of driving a vehicle and round circular orbit;Fixed station 4 is trapezoidal erecting bed, 2 one end of rotating arm rotational installation
In 4 upper end of fixed station;Wherein, 2 other end of rotating arm is equipped with shaft 5, in shaft 5 rotation connection bicycle former and later two
Vehicle frame 31 and 32 is equipped with spring 6 above the Rear frame 32 of the bicycle 3, and the shaft interlocks 8 main shaft of decelerating motor, voluntarily
Decelerating motor 8 provides power-assisted when vehicle rises, and decelerating motor 8 provides resistance when bicycle declines.
1 two sides of guide rail are fixed vertically by guide rail 1 by installation column 7.
The effective distance of the rotating arm 2 and bicycle 3 is equal to round circular orbit radius.
The fixed station 4 is located at 1 side of guide rail, and 4 height of fixed station is greater than 1 radius of guide rail and is less than diameter.
The bicycle 3 is equipped with safety belt.
The minimum point contact ground of the guide rail 1 or slightly above ground.
